St Georges school for girls

3 replies

Bearby10 · 22/01/2018 14:13

Hi
Just wondering if anyone has any experience of St George’s? I am thinking of sending my daughter there for P6. She is currently at a co-ed school in Edinburgh but I have been impressed by the class sizes and the pastoral care on offer at St G’s. Thanks.

OP posts:
TopangaD · 22/01/2018 17:20

We had a look around st their last open day and were very impressed. Not sure we can afford it so unlikely to move forward with a place but I thought it was s great school and liked how the junior school connects to senior. I would recommend getting in touch and booking to go for a tour. I know a few friends with girls there and a few of the teaching staff it’s a great school

guessmyusername · 25/01/2018 22:02

We looked at it for dd a while back but were concerned about the GCSEs and A levels in a number of subjects and preferred the broader Scottish curriculum so decided against it. I don't know if that is still the case so worth checking

YummyTwinMummy · 04/02/2018 17:01

Hi,

I have twin daughters in Remove (P7) at St George's. This is by far the best school they've ever attended and they've had to move all over the world for my husband's work.

GCSE's are still done but they do Highers and Advanced Highers.
